Chemical Name: cis-2-[[(3,5-Dichlorophenyl)amino]carbonyl]cyclohexanec arboxylic acid

Biological Activity

Potent, positive allosteric modulator/allosteric agonist at mGlu4 receptors (EC50 = 798 and 693 nM at human and rat mGlu4 receptors respectively). Active in in vivo models of Parkinson's disease following i.c.v. administration.

Technical Data

M.Wt:
316.18
Formula:
C14H15Cl2NO3
Solubility:
Soluble to 100 mM in 1eq. NaOH and to 100 mM in DMSO
Purity:
>99 %
Storage:
Store at RT
